Transaction

8adc4f1650b4ec92280e427ebf22e1c0dc3a5cd972b202e05bec410b313ee99c

Summary

In Block316625
TimeThu, 17 Aug 2023 17:03:00 UTC
Total Input2451.39182136 Nebula
Total Output2451.39175776 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
574715 Confirmations2451.39175776 Nebula
Raw Transaction